"Who can I trust?" Arthur asked anxiously. The Old One responded, suggesting that trust should be placed in people who genuinely care about him, not those who aim to manipulate or use him for their own purposes. The emphasis is on discernment and choosing allies wisely.

The Old One's words imply that one should be proactive and strategic, taking control of their own fate rather than passively being manipulated. It's better to be a player in life's game, making conscious decisions, than to be a pawn controlled by others' intentions.
